Dr. Trotter completed his undergraduate studies and Dental School at Indiana University. Upon graduation, he entered the United States Navy as a Lieutenant and began his general dentistry career at Marine Corps Recruit Depot, Parris Island, SC. Further tours of duty included Guam and the Washington Navy Yard. He completed his Oral and Maxillofacial residency at Naval Medical Center Portsmouth (NMCP). Subsequently, he served three years as the Oral Surgeon at Naval Hospital, Naples, Italy and then as attending staff at the NMCP residency program. After completing 13 years of active duty, he continued in the Naval Reserves achieving the rank of Captain.
Dr. Trotter practiced for 14 years at Southside Oral & Facial Surgery in Chester, Hopewell and Petersburg, Virginia before he purchased the practice from Dr. Mrazik in 2016 and starting Hampton Oral & Facial Surgery. He has served as the President of the Southside Dental Society of the Virginia Dental Association, on the Executive Council for the Virginia Society of Oral and Maxillofacial Surgeons and as the Treasurer of the Apollonia Dental Study Club, in Richmond, Va. He has been a part-time faculty member of VCU Department of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ery. Dr. Trotter volunteers his time and talent for various Virginia Dental Association programs such as the Mission of Mercy, Donated Dental Services and Give Kids a Smile.
